AI Summary
- Designates February 12, 2018, as Lake Lanier Day at the Georgia state capitol
- Lake Lanier covers 38,000 acres, attracts over 11 million visitors annually, and contributes $300 million each year to the counties of Hall, Forsyth, Gwinnett, Dawson, and Lumpkin
- Provides life-sustaining water supply to over four million residents in the Metro Atlanta region
- Recognizes the Lake Lanier Association, which represents over 4,000 Georgia residents and has worked for over 50 years to keep the lake clean, full, and safe
- Directs the Secretary of the Senate to provide a copy of the resolution to the Lake Lanier Association
